Preparing your Door

Before you begin:
• Disable locks.
• Remove any ropes connected to door.
• Complete the following test to make sure your door is balanced and
is not sticking or binding:
1. Lift the door about halfway as shown. Release the door. If balanced,
it should stay in place, supported entirely by its springs.
2. Raise and lower the door to see if there is any binding or sticking.

ASSEMBLY STEP 1

Attach the Collar to the Motor Unit

To avoid installation difficulties, do not run the door operator until
instructed to do so.
Loosen the collar screws (1).
Attach collar to either the left or the right side of the motor unit.
Ensure that the collar is seated all the way on motor shaft until stop is
reached.
Position the collar so that the screws are facing up (accessible when
attached to the torsion bar).
Tighten both sides of collar screws equally to secure collar to the
motor unit (16Nm-19Nm . of torque).
Use Hex bits 1/8" from hardwarebag..
NOTE: For most installations the screws should be facing up for easy
access. Do not tighten set screws until indicated.
ASSEMBLY STEP 2
Attach Mounting Bracket to Motor Unit
Loosely attach slotted side of mounting bracket to the same side of
the motor unit as the collar, using self-threading screws provided.
NOTE: Do not tighten until instructed. Illustrations shown are for left side
installation.
Alternate Mounting Kit
(480LM OPTIONAL):
This kit allows model LM3800A to be mounted below the torsion bar in
the case where the torsion bar is not round or the normal mounting area
is obstructed.
To prevent possible SERIOUS INJURY or DEATH, the collar MUST
be properly tightened. The door may not reverse correctly or limits
may be lost due to collar slip.
